"Der Steppenwolf" is a profound exploration of the human psyche and a landmark of 20th-century modernism. The novel follows Harry Haller, a disillusioned intellectual who perceives himself as being divided between two distinct natures: a refined, socialized human and a savage, solitary "Steppenwolf." Trapped in a cycle of isolation and despair within a society he despises, Haller's life takes a transformative turn when he encounters the enigmatic Hermine and is introduced to the "Magic Theater." This surreal, hallucinatory space serves as a stage where Haller must confront the many fragments of his identity and learn the liberating power of laughter and self-acceptance.

Written by Hermann Hesse, this work is a masterful blend of psychological depth and philosophical inquiry, touching on themes of alienation, the constraints of bourgeois life, and the quest for spiritual unity. Its innovative structure and enduring relevance have established "Der Steppenwolf" as a classic of world literature. It remains a poignant and essential read for those navigating the complexities of the self and seeking to reconcile the conflicting forces within the human soul.
